1783 CE1845 CE · Acharonim · Karlsburg (Alba Iulia)

Yechezkel Panet was the chief rabbi of Transylvania and the leading legal authority for the Jews of that region in the early 1800s. His collected halachic rulings are known by the title Mareh Yechezkel.
